| Description | Concerning: problems receiving goods due to poor weather and having to smuggle some items from the ship; the cutting out shop; French spies and suspicions of plagiarism, including the visitation of a man on General Alabiouff's recommendation who turned out to be connected to the Mint in Siberia; Speedyman's health; and the disappearance of a ship [Robert Gowham?] on the coast of Sweden. [21 December 1802 N.S.] |
